Interview with Angerfist: “It is an exciting year indeed”

You are this year’s highest ranked hardcore artist in the DJ mag top 100 (#37), you just released a brand new 3CD-album and on top of that, on November 29th your own event will take place in the Brabanthallen in ’s Hertogenbosch (NL). Sounds like a pretty succesful year, is that also how you experience it?

“It’s an exciting year indeed. Many things happening and many cool things to come. Currently I’m mostly hyped for the event this saturday.”

(How) are you gonna top this in 2015? What are your plans for the upcoming year?

“The Deadfaced Dimension event is somewhat of a kickoff for the world tour that will start in december and will go on into 2015. There will be quite a few new countries on the list as well as the more familiar territory. And of course I will keep making new music in 2015. There are already some plans for new projects that will start when the busiest part of the tour has passed.”

Last week you released your album ‘The Deadfaced Dimension’. Can you tell something about the creation of this album?

“I’ve been working on it since the beginning of the summer. In my opinion this is my best album so far because of the diversity in tracks and styles. I also did collaborations and remixes with many artists that all have their own unique style and helped make the album to what it is. I’m proud of the result.”

How did everyone react?

“Fans seem to agree with me, all feedback has been very good. When I play the tracks on my gigs, the response is great as well. You never know how people will react when you release something, so I’m happy with all the positivity around it.”

Do you have any favorite tracks you are extra proud of?

“It’s not easy to choose from all these tracks, but my personal favorite of the album has to be “Messing With The Wrong Man”. I really like the oldskoolish amen breaks with that rumbling bassline under it. The 200 bpm aggressive beats, synths and screaming vocals are just perfect for closing a set with and to get the crowd in destruction mode.”

You teamed up with Art of Dance for your own event in the Brabanthallen on november 29th. How did that go?

“After the succesful previous events and tours that I did with Art Of Dance I knew that they would be the best choice to team up with for The Deadfaced Dimension. I got the idea for this project and they were very interested. So we sat down and started planning the event.”

Support acts for this event are among others Miss K8, Partyraiser, Peacock and Wasted Mind. What does it mean to you that all these artist will join you at this event?

“It’s great. Again, all have their own style and will add bigtime to the vibe of the event. I will also perform together with many of them, which will be cool. Really looking forward to it.”

Can you give us a sneak preview? What can we expect?

“The visual world of ‘The Deadfaced Dimension’ will be a secret until the doors open on Saturday. Of course I released the album already, so all fans can musically prepare themselves for the coming madness on-stage. The stage contains big build silo’s, brutal led walls, destructive sound and the best light, laser and flamethrowers available. The final outcome is only for those who enter the Angerfist domain :)”

Do you have a message for everyone that will come to your event on November 29th or the people that are still considering it?

“If you’re a real hardcorehead, you don’t want to miss this one. It’s going to be a violent madhouse. Come prepared and raise your FIST!”
